--- Comment #8 from Sam Kellar <sk...@my.fit.edu> ---
I was able to successfully replicate this bug with Apache OpenOffice 4.1.2 on
Microsoft Windows 10 (Anniversary Update from 8.1)

Steps to reproduce in Writer:

1. Format > Bullets and Numbering… > Outline
2. Select Numeric, numeric, lowercase letters, solid small circular bullet
(Row: 0, Column: 0)
3. Type some text
4. Press Enter
5. Press Tab or Demote One Level
6. Repeat steps 3-5
7. Repeat steps 3-5
8. Type some text

Expected Result:
The spacing between the outline bullets/numbering and the text is consistent
throughout each level of the outline.

Actual Result:
The spacing between the outline bullets/numbering and the text is inconsistent
on the second level (1.1) of the outline.

--- Comment #15 from mroe <mr...@gmx.net> ---
The problem lies in the positioning by tabulators.
With sublevels the numbering grows over the tab position so that the following
text slips to the next tab stop. And in dependence of font and font size this
results also in something like at 9./10./11./…

There are different solutions. E. G. highlight the complete numbering, goto
Format → Bullets and Numbering…: Position
and change the Numbering alignment to Right. Maybe you have additional to
adjust something other.

--- Comment #11 from Sam Kellar <sk...@my.fit.edu> ---
After comparing the outline formats of Microsoft Word 2013 and Apache
OpenOffice Writer 4.1.2, I found that there are similar spacing behaviours used
in both for the numeric sublevels.

However, Word appears to increase the fixed-width space between outline and
text as the sublevels grow (up to 4), whereas Writer appears to decrease the
space. As such, the mixing of numeric and other outline types in Writer causes
unexpected formatting.
